Functions of CLDP

Data Driven Career Planning and Placement Strategy

Provide structured counselling for career mapping and long-term goal setting. Conduct psychometric assessments and personality profiling to identify career fitment. Track placement metrics, salary trends, recruiter feedback, and sector-wise hiring patterns. Develop evidence-based placement strategies aligned with evolving industry demand.

Talent Mapping & Skill Development

Organize training in soft skills, communication, aptitude and group discussions. Facilitate sessions on résumé building, personal branding and interview preparation. Align student competency development with market demand insights and recruiter expectations. Identify skill gaps through assessments and design targeted capability enhancement programs.

Corporate Alliances & Industry Connect

Establish & maintain corporate relationships for placements, internships, and industry projects. Organize industry-led sessions, expert talks, panel discussions, and leadership conclaves. Strengthen employer engagement through regular outreach and institutional collaborations. Create sector-specific recruitment networks to expand career opportunities.

Strategic MoUs & Corporate Partnerships

Initiate and formalize Memorandums of Understanding (MoUs) with industries, corporates, and institutions. Build long-term partnerships for internships, placements, research collaboration, and knowledge exchange. Facilitate collaborative programs such as certification courses, joint workshops, and applied projects. Expand strategic alliances to enhance institutional visibility and employer trust.

Internships, Live Projects and PPO Pipelines

Identify & facilitate relevant summer/winter internships and live industry projects. Monitor and evaluate student performance in real-world corporate engagements. Develop Pre-Placement Offer (PPO) pipelines through sustained employer partnerships. Ensure experiential learning opportunities aligned with academic and career objectives.

Employer Relations, Branding & Placement Facilitation

Invite reputed organizations for campus recruitment and hiring drives. Coordinate pre-placement talks, group discussions, assessments, and personal interviews. Promote institutional brand visibility among recruiters through employer engagement initiatives.

Alumni Networking and Mentorship

Maintain a strong alumni network to support mentoring, internships, and placement activities. Organize alumni interactions, career talks, and success story showcases. Engage alumni as mentors for career guidance and industry insights. Leverage alumni networks for employer referrals and corporate introductions.

Industry Interface & Experiential Exposure

Arrange industrial visits to provide practical exposure to corporate operations and business practices. Promote interaction with entrepreneurs, business leaders, and domain experts. Facilitate experiential learning through simulations, case challenges, and field immersions. Enhance industry readiness through direct exposure to workplace environments.

Continuous Feedback & Quality Enhancement

Collect structured feedback from recruiters, alumni, and students post-placement. Identify competency gaps and enhance curriculum delivery and training interventions accordingly. Review placement outcomes periodically to refine strategies and processes. Implement continuous improvement mechanisms to strengthen employability outcomes.

Flagship Programme

Students Transformation Programme

The Students Transformation Programme (STP) at ACCMAN Institute of Management is a comprehensive developmental initiative designed to transform students into confident, industry-ready professionals. The programme focuses on enhancing employability by systematically strengthening communication, interpersonal effectiveness, professional etiquette, leadership orientation, and workplace readiness. Delivered through structured modules by experienced trainers, corporate mentors, and industry experts, STP integrates experiential learning with practical application to ensure holistic personality and career development.

The programme adopts a progressive trimester/semester-wise approach, enabling students to build competencies in a phased and outcome-driven manner. Each stage is aligned with academic progression and evolving industry expectations, ensuring that students are prepared to meet professional challenges with competence and confidence.

Key Objectives of STP

  • Strengthen commun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ills essential for professional success.
  • Build confidence in public speaking, group interaction, & workplace communication.
  • Develop professional etiquette, corporate behavior, & leadership capabilities.
  • Enhance employability through structured training in interview readiness and recruitment preparation.
  • Foster adaptability, problem-solving ability, and decision-making skills required in dynamic business environments.
Curriculum

Trimester-wise Modules

Trimester I

Foundation for Professional Communication

  • • Spoken English
  • • Body Language
  • • Confidence Building and Self-Expression
  • • Professional Grooming Basics
Trimester II

Communication Excellence and Expression

  • • Communication Skills
  • • Presentation Skills
  • • Extempore Speaking
  • • Verbal and Non-Verbal Communication Effectiveness
Trimester III

Corporate Interaction and Workplace Readiness

  • • Group Discussion Techniques
  • • Resume Preparation and Profiling
  • • Email Etiquettes and Business Correspondence
  • • Corporate Role Plays and Workplace Simulations
Trimester IV

Career Readiness and Leadership Development

  • • Interview Skills and Mock Interview Practice
  • • Industry Readiness Modules
  • • Leadership Skill Development
  • • Decision-Making and Team Management Exercises

Programme Outcomes

Improved professional communication and workplace confidence
Enhanced readiness for internships, placements, & corporate interactions
Stronger leadership, teamwork, and interpersonal effectiveness
Greater alignment with employer expectations and industry standards

Industry Interface

Live Projects

From the first trimester, students are actively engaged in non-sales, core domain live projects, enabling them to gain hands-on experience and develop skills aligned with real industry roles.

Thought Leader Dialogue

Thought Leader Dialogues provide students with direct interaction opportunities with Industry Experts, CA’s, CXOs, Entrepreneurs and Domain Specialists. These sessions offer valuable insights into emerging market trends, leadership perspectives and contemporary business challenges, bridging the gap between academic learning and corporate realities.

Industry Visits & Experiential Learning

Industry Industry Visits and Experiential Learning initiatives expose students to real-world organizational environments, operational practices, and business processes. Through guided corporate visits, plant tours, and immersive field exposure, students gain practical understanding of industry dynamics and strengthen their professional readiness.

Haier Industrial Visit
Visit

Haier — Industrial Visit

The visit to Haier provided students with valuable insights into manufacturing excellence and operational efficiency. From assembly lines to advanced automation, students observed how precision, quality control, and streamlined processes contribute to building a globally recognized brand. The experience enhanced their understanding of real-world production systems and operations management.

IFFCO — Industrial Visit

Students visited IFFCO (Indian Farmers Fertilizer Cooperative Limited), gaining first-hand exposure to India's cooperative business model, sustainable agricultural practices, and employee welfare initiatives. The visit offered a comprehensive understanding of large-scale industrial operations and reinforced key concepts of cooperative management.

Incubation

GIS Incubation Center, GIMS

During their visit to the GIS Incubation Center, GIMS, students attended an insightful session led by the center's leadership. The interaction provided valuable insights into startup incubation, innovation management, funding mechanisms, and entrepreneurship development, encouraging students to explore entrepreneurial opportunities.

National Finance Conclave — Vigyan Bhawan

Students participated in the National Finance Conclave organized by ICPA at Vigyan Bhawan, New Delhi. The event offered exposure to national-level financial discussions, interactions with industry experts and policymakers, and insights into emerging trends in finance, accounting, and governance — broadening their professional perspective.

Reserve Bank of India — RBI New Delhi

Students had the opportunity to present their ideas at the Reserve Bank of India, New Delhi, during the Digital Payments Awareness Week – Idea Pitch Competition. The experience provided exposure to financial innovation, digital payments, and financial inclusion. The participation enhanced industry understanding and reinforced confidence in addressing real-world financial challenges.

Placement Cell — Policies & Process

A transparent and well-defined framework that governs the entire placement journey.
Mandatory Registration
  • All students must register with the Placement Department to participate in campus placement activities.
  • Only registered students will be considered eligible for placement opportunities.
Communication Protocol
  • Direct communication with company representatives is not permitted.
  • All placement-related communication must be routed through the Placement Department.
Policy Amendments
  • The Placement Department reserves the right to revise or update the placement policy at any time
  • Changes will be implemented per institutional requirements and industry dynamics.
Eligibility Criteria
  • Students must satisfy academic, attendance, and conduct requirements for placement participation.
  • Eligibility for specific organizations depends on recruiter-defined criteria.
Application Commitment
  • Students may apply only for roles relevant to their eligibility and career interests.
  • Once shortlisted, participation in the selection process is mandatory unless formally approved otherwise.
Offer Acceptance Norms
  • Students must communicate acceptance or rejection of offers within the stipulated timeline.
  • Acceptance of an offer may limit participation in subsequent placement drives per institute norms.
Professional Conduct
  • Students must maintain punctuality, discipline, and professional etiquette throughout the placement cycle.
  • Any misconduct may result in disqualification from placement activities.
Attendance in Placement Activities
  • Attendance in Pre-Placement Talks, tests, interviews, and related activities is compulsory for shortlisted candidates.
  • Absence without prior approval may lead to suspension from future placement opportunities.
Authentic Information Disclosure
  • Students must provide accurate and verified information in resumes, applications, and supporting documents.
  • Misrepresentation or falsification may result in immediate disqualification.
Withdrawal Policy
  • Withdrawal from a recruitment process after confirmation is discouraged unless approved by the Placement Department.
  • Unauthorized withdrawal may invite disciplinary action under placement regulations.
Internship & PPO Reporting
  • All Pre-Placement Offers (PPOs) received through internships must be reported promptly to the Placement Department.
  • PPO acceptance shall be governed by institutional placement norms.
Final Decision Authority
  • The decisions of the recruiter and the Placement Department in all placement matters shall be final and binding.
  • No appeal or exception shall override the authority of the Placement Department.
